restraint
(noun)
noun
1. the act of controlling by restraining someone or something
- the unlawful restraint of trade
Definition categories: act, control
2. discipline in personal and social activities
- he was a model of polite restraint
Similar word(s): control
Definition categories: attribute, discipline
3. the state of being physically constrained
- dogs should be kept under restraint
Similar word(s): constraint
Definition categories: state, confinement
4. a rule or condition that limits freedom
- legal restraints
- restraints imposed on imports
Definition categories: thought, limitation, restriction
5. lack of ornamentation
- the room was simply decorated with great restraint
Similar word(s): chasteness, simpleness, simplicity
Definition categories: attribute, plainness
6. a device that retards something's motion
- the car did not have proper restraints fitted
Similar word(s): constraint
Definition categories: man–made, device
